Cognitive and Emotional Resilience: Thriving in a Changing World
In today's rapidly evolving world, strengthening cognitive and emotional resilience is paramount. People who possess these qualities are better equipped to adapt in the before challenges and change. Cognitive resilience comprises the skill to {think critically, problem-solve, and learn from experiences|. Emotional resilience, on the other hand, refers to the capacity to manage emotions effectively in challenging situations.
A well-rounded approach to building resilience consists of a variety of methods. Mindfulness practices, such as meditation and deep breathing exercises, can help people develop emotional regulation. Additionally, engaging in physical activity can have a favorable impact on both cognitive and emotional well-being. It's also crucial to cultivate supportive relationships as these provide validation during difficult periods.
By adopting these strategies, humans can enhance their cognitive and emotional resilience, preparing themselves to navigate the constant changes that life throws their way.

Strengthening Inner Strength: Developing Cognitive and Emotional Agility
Inner strength isn't merely about physical prowess; it's a deeply rooted state of mental resilience and resourcefulness. Fostering this inner fortitude involves honing both our cognitive and emotional agility, equipping us to navigate the inevitable challenges life throws our way. Cognitive agility refers to our ability to think clearly, adapt our outlook and tackle problems with innovation. Emotionally, agility means processing our feelings authentically while controlling their impact on our thoughts and actions. A strong foundation in both aspects allows us to thrive even in the face of adversity, emerging as more resilient and balanced individuals.
